Abstract

The article presents the characteristics of two research projects conducted by the Department of Slavic Philology in the Faculty of Arts at Comenius University in Bratislava, focused on the field of ethnolinguistics and ethnophraseology, which pertain to the perception of the supernatural in languages and cultures of the West Slavic and South Slavic areas. Particular emphasis is placed on the perspective of applying the knowledge gained during the research in the educational process, for instance, within lectures such as “Slavic Linguistic Image of the World”, “Slavic Phraseology”, “Slavic Dialectology”, as well as in designing topics for final papers, and so on.
